Liverpool have made a £9.5m bid for Udinese midfielder Piotr Zielinski as manager Jurgen Klopp looks to boost his midfield options, Sky sources understand.

The Poland international, who was an unused substitute in Sunday's 1-0 win over Northern Ireland at Euro 2016, has spent the last two years on loan at Empoli.

Piotr Zielinski of Empoli FC looks on during the Serie A match between Empoli FC and Bologna FC at Stadio Carlo Castellani on May 1
Image: Liverpool have bid for Zielinski, who played for Empoli last season

The 22-year-old is wanted by Napoli but it is believed Anfield is the player's preferred destination and there were claims in the Italian media that Klopp has called Zielinski to outline his plans.

"I negotiated for Zielinski with the Pozzo family and we finalised every detail," Napoli president Aurelio de Laurentiis told Corriere dello Sport.

"Instead, it now seems as if the player is doing everything possible to resist the move and not come here. He wants Liverpool."

Klopp has already signed Schalke centre-back Joel Matip, Red Star Belgrade midfielder Marko Grujic and Mainz goalkeeper Loris Karius for next season as his squad strengthening continues.
